Depression is a complex mental health condition that affects millions of individuals worldwide. It is not merely a fleeting feeling of sadness; rather, it is a pervasive state that can significantly impair one’s ability to function in daily life.

You may find yourself grappling with persistent feelings of hopelessness, fatigue, and a lack of interest in activities that once brought you joy.

The symptoms can vary widely, ranging from emotional distress to physical ailments, making it crucial to understand the multifaceted nature of this condition. Recognising the signs of depression is the first step towards seeking help and finding effective coping strategies. The causes of depression are equally varied and can include genetic predispositions, environmental factors, and psychological influences.

You might be surprised to learn that even seemingly minor life events can trigger depressive episodes in susceptible individuals. Stressful situations such as job loss, relationship breakdowns, or the death of a loved one can act as catalysts for this debilitating condition. Understanding these triggers can empower you to take proactive steps in managing your mental health.

It is essential to remember that depression is not a sign of weakness; it is a legitimate medical condition that requires attention and care.

The Role of Spirituality in Mental Health: Exploring the Connection

Spirituality often plays a significant role in how individuals cope with mental health challenges, including depression. For many, spirituality provides a sense of purpose and connection to something greater than themselves. You may find that engaging in spiritual practices—whether through prayer, meditation, or community involvement—can foster resilience and offer comfort during difficult times.

This connection can serve as a powerful tool for healing, helping you navigate the complexities of your emotional landscape. Moreover, spirituality can encourage a shift in perspective, allowing you to view your struggles through a different lens. When faced with the weight of depression, you might discover that spiritual beliefs can instil hope and provide a framework for understanding your experiences.

This sense of belonging and support can be invaluable, as it reminds you that you are not alone in your journey. By exploring your spiritual beliefs and practices, you may uncover new pathways to healing and personal growth.

What is Spiritual Hypnosis? A Guide to the Practice and Its Benefits

Spiritual hypnosis is an integrative approach that combines traditional hypnosis techniques with spiritual principles. This practice aims to facilitate deep relaxation and heightened awareness, allowing you to access your subconscious mind more effectively. During a session, you may be guided by a trained practitioner who helps you explore your inner thoughts and feelings while tapping into your spiritual beliefs.

This unique blend can lead to profound insights and transformative experiences. The benefits of spiritual hypnosis are numerous. You might find that it helps alleviate anxiety and stress, enhances self-awareness, and promotes emotional healing.

By delving into your subconscious mind, you can uncover underlying issues contributing to your depression, enabling you to address them more effectively. Additionally, spiritual hypnosis can foster a sense of connection to your inner self and the universe, which may provide comfort and clarity during challenging times. As you engage with this practice, you may discover new ways to cope with your mental health struggles.

Overcoming Stigma: Addressing Misconceptions About Hypnosis and Spirituality

Despite its potential benefits, misconceptions about hypnosis and spirituality persist in society. You may have encountered scepticism regarding the efficacy of these practices or even experienced stigma surrounding mental health issues. It is essential to recognise that these misconceptions can hinder individuals from seeking the help they need.

By addressing these misunderstandings, we can create a more supportive environment for those exploring alternative therapies like spiritual hypnosis. One common misconception is that hypnosis involves losing control or being manipulated by the practitioner. In reality, hypnosis is a collaborative process where you remain fully aware and in control throughout the session.

Your willingness to engage with the process is crucial for its success. Additionally, some may view spirituality as incompatible with scientific approaches to mental health; however, many practitioners integrate both perspectives to provide holistic care. By fostering open conversations about these topics, you can help dismantle stigma and encourage others to explore the healing potential of spiritual hypnosis.

Finding a Qualified Practitioner: Tips for Seeking Spiritual Hypnosis Therapy

If you are considering spiritual hypnosis as a therapeutic option, finding a qualified practitioner is essential for ensuring a safe and effective experience. Start by researching professionals who specialise in this area; look for credentials such as certifications in hypnosis and relevant mental health training. You may also want to seek recommendations from trusted sources or read reviews from previous clients to gauge their experiences.

When meeting with potential practitioners, don’t hesitate to ask questions about their approach and experience with spiritual hypnosis. It’s important that you feel comfortable and supported during the process. A good practitioner will take the time to understand your unique needs and tailor their approach accordingly.

Trust your instincts; if something doesn’t feel right during an initial consultation, it’s perfectly acceptable to seek out another professional who aligns better with your values and goals.
